Your Browser is not longer supported

Please use Google Chrome, Mozilla Firefox or Microsoft Edge to view the page correctly
Loading...

{{viewport.spaceProperty.prod}}

Installing FTP and TELNET via SDF command

&pagelevel(3)&pagelevel

The SDF command SET-FTP-TELNET-PARAMETERS offers the following functionality:


SET-FTP-TELNET-PARAMETERS
FTP-SERVER-PROC = *NO / *CREATE(...)

*CREATE(...)

|JOB-NAME = *STD / <name 1..5>

|, JOB-CLASS = *STD / <name 1..8>

|, CPU-TIME = *STD / <integer 1..32767>

|, PRIORITY = *STD / <integer 0..255>

|, DEBUG = *STD / <integer 0..9>

|, TRACE = *STD / <integer 0..9>

|, MAXIMUM-CONNECTIONS = *STD / <integer 1..900>

|, STATION-ID = *STD / <integer 0..6>

|, TRANSFER-JOB-CLASS = *STD / <name 1..8>

|, TRANSFER-CPU-TIME = *STD / <integer 1..32767>

|, TIMEOUT-VALUE = *STD / <integer 1..32767>

|, SYSTEM-EXIT-LEVEL = *STD / <integer 0..3>
 |, FTAC-SUPPORT = *STD / *NO / *YES(...),

|
*YES(...)

|
|LEVEL = *STD / <integer 1..2>

|
|, JOB-CLASS = *STD / <name 1..8>

|
|, ENTER-FILE = *STD / <filename 1..54_without-generation-version>

|
|, SERVER-INFORMATION-FILE = *STD / <filename 1..54_without-generation-version>

|
|, FTAC-USERID = *STD /<name 1..8>

|, TLS-SUPPORT = *STD / *NO / *YES(...)

|
*YES(...)

|
|PROTOCOL = *STD / <text 1..80>

|
|, MIN-PROTOCOL-VERSION = *STD / *TLSV1.2

|
|, MAX-PROTOCOL-VERSION = *STD / *TLSV1.2

|
|, CIPHER-SUITE = *STD / <text 1..511>

|
|, RSA-CERTIFICATE-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, RSA-KEY-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, DSA-CERTIFICATE-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, DSA-KEY-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, CA-CERTIFICATE-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, CLIENT-CA-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, CERT-CHAIN-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, CA-REVOCATION-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, RANDOM-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, SSL-LIBRARY =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, VERIFY-CLIENT = *STD / *NONE / *OPTIONAL / *REQUIRE

|
|, VERIFY-DEPTH = *STD / <1..32767>

|
|, SEC-CONTROL-CONN = *STD / *NONE / *OPTIONAL / *REQUIRE

|
|, SEC-DATA-CONN = *STD / *NONE / *OPTIONAL / *REQUIRE

|
|, SERVER-PREFERENCE = *STD / *NO / *YES

|
|, PRIORITIZE-CHACHA = *STD / *NO / *YES

|, ACCOUNTING = *STD / *NO / *YES(...)

|
*YES(...)

|
|FILE = *STD / <filename 1..54_without-generation-version>

|, OPTION-FILE = *STD / <filename 1..54_without-generation-version>

|, SELECTOR = *STD / <text 1..511>

|, INITIAL-COMMANDS = *STD / <c-string 2..256>

|, PORT-NUMBER = *STD / <integer 1..32767>

|, SERVER-ENTER-FILE = *STD / <filename 1..54_without-generation-version>

|, LOGGING-FILE = *STD / <filename 1..54_without-generation-version>

|, ALLOW-TSOS-LOGIN = *STD / *NO / *YES / *TLS

|, TVFS = *STD / *NO / *YES
, TELNET-SERVER-PROC = *NO / *CREATE(...)

*CREATE(...)

|JOB-NAME = *STD / <name 1..5>

|, JOB-CLASS = *STD / <name 1..8>

|, CPU-TIME = *STD / <integer 1..32767>

|, PRIORITY= *STD / <integer 0..255>

|, DEBUG = *STD / <integer 0..9>

|, TRACE = *STD / <integer 0..9>

|, MAXIMUM-CONNECTIONS = *STD / <integer 1..900>

|, STATION-ID = *STD / <integer 0..6>

|, ASCII-TABLE = *STD / <text 1..8>

|, EBCDIC-TABLE = *STD / <name 1..8>

|, TLS-SUPPORT = *STD / *NO / *PARAMETERS(...)

|
*PARAMETERS (...)

|
|OPTION = *STD / *START-TLS / *AUTHENTICATION(...)

|
|
*AUTHENTICATION(...)


|
|
|DEBUG = *STD / *NO / *YES


|
|, PROTOCOL = *STD / <text 1..80>

|
|, MIN-PROTOCOL-VERSION = *STD / *TLSV1.2 / *TLSV1.3

|
|, MAX-PROTOCOL-VERSION = *STD / *TLSV1.2 / *TLSV1.3

|
|, CIPHER-SUITE = *STD / <text 1..80>

|
|, CIPHER-SUITE-TLSV13 = *STD / <text 1..511>

|
|, RSA-CERTIFICATE-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, RSA-KEY-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, DSA-CERTIFICATE-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, DSA-KEY-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, CA-CERTIFICATE-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, CERT-CHAIN--F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, CA-REVOCATION-FILE =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, RANDOM-FILE = *STD / <filename 1..54_without-generation-version>

|
|, SSL-LIBRARY = *STD / *NONE / <filename 1..54_without-generation-version>

|
|, VERIFY-CLIENT = *STD / *NONE / *OPTIONAL / *REQUIRE

|
|, VERIFY-DEPTH = *STD / <1..32767>

|, ENCRYPTION = *STD / *NO / *YES(...)

|
*YES(...)

|
|DEBUG = *STD / *NO / *YES

|
|, KEY= <x-text 1..16>

|
|, SSL-LIBRARY = *STD / *NONE / <filename 1..54_without-generation-version>

|, OPTION-FILE = *STD / <filename 1..54_without-generation-version>

|, SELECTOR = *STD / <text 1..511>

|, PORT-NUMBER = *STD / <integer 0..32767>

|, SERVER-ENTER-FILE = *STD / <filename 1..54_without-generation-version>

|, LOGGING-FILE = *STD / <filename 1..54_without-generation-version>
, START-PROCEDURE = *NO / *CREATE


Shared operands of FTP and TELNET

START-PROCEDURE = *NO / *CREATE
Specifies whether the SYSENT.TCP-IP-AP.nnn.START file will be created, which contains the start enter file for FTP and TELNET.

START-PROCEDURE = *NO
The file will not be created.

START-PROCEDURE = *CREATE
The file will be created.


Return codes of SET-FTP-TELNET-PARAMETERS commands

(SC2)

SC1

Maincode

Meaning/Guaranteed messages


0TCP9000INSTALLATION WAS TERMINATED SUCCESSFULLY

1CMD0202SYNTAX ERROR IN COMMAND (this return code occurs with syntax errors, which are identified at the level of the SDF command definitions.)

1TCP9002INVALID FILE NAME: (&00)

1TCP9003THE PASSWORD (&00) IS NOT VALID.

1TCP9004THE INSTALLATION KEY (&00) IS NOT VALID.

1TCP9005THE ID (&00) IS NOT VALID.

1TCP9006THE BS2000 VERSION (&00) IS NOT VALID.

1TCP9007THE LOGON NAME (&00) IS NOT VALID.

1TCP9008(&00) MAXIMUM CONNECTIONS ARE IN AN INVALID AREA.

1TCP9009THE (&01) PARAMETER (&00) IS NOT VALID.

1TCP9010THE JOB CLASS (&00) IS NOT VALID.

1TCP9011THE CPU LIMIT (&00) IS NOT VALID.

1TCP9012SET (&00) PARAMETERS.

1TCP9014THE PRIORITY (&00) IS NOT VALID.

1TCP9015THE DCAM APPLICATION NAME (&00) IS NOT VALID.

1TCP9016THE PORT NUMBER (&00) IS NOT VALID.

1TCP9017THE VALUE (&00) FOR PORT MONITORING IS NOT CORRECT.

1TCP9018THE VALUE (&00) FOR AUTORIZATION SERVICE IS NOT CORRECT.

1TCP9020THE NUMBER OF POSITIONS FOR GENERATING THE DCAM APPLICATION NAME(&00) IS NOT VALID.

1TCP9021THE STANDARD ASCII CODE TABLE (&00) IS NOT VALID.

1TCP9022THE STANDARD EBCDIC CODE TABLE (&00) IS NOT VALID.

1TCP9023SDF ERROR READING THE STATEMENT.

64TCP9200OPENING OF (&00) NOT POSSIBLE: DVS: (&01)

64TCP9201WRITE ERROR IN INSTALLATION FILE: DVS: (&00)

64TCP9202INSTALLATION PROGRAM AND PARAMETER FILE ARE NOT THE SAME VERSION.

64TCP9203FILE COMMANDO COULD NOT BE ISSUED.

64TCP9205INSTALLATION (&00) WAS NOT FOUND. DVS:(&01)

64TCP9206(&00) ENTER DATEI COULD NOT BE CREATED. DVS:(&01)

64TCP9207INST. FILE (&00) CANNOT BE CLOSED. DVS:(&01)

64TCP9208MSG GROUP TCP COULD NOT BE INSTALLED. CODE (&00)

64TCP9209READ ERROR IN INSTALLATION FILE (&00)